If taxpayers voted on TIF, it likely would not pass

To the editor:

The article Sunday by Bob Miller on tax increment financing was very interesting. If the developer cannot do the whole project, then he should do it in increments without taxpayers' money. I have and always will object to using taxpayers' revenue to support a developer's dreams. The proposed TIF should be voted on. Let the taxpayers decide. I do not think it would pass. If TIF is passed, you can be assured the taxpayers will remember with a vengeance any tax increases in the future.
